Melon Pan
Melon Pan, despite its name, doesn't actually taste like melon. It's a popular Japanese sweet bread with a crispy, cookie-like crust that resembles the texture of a melon. The bread inside is soft and fluffy, typically flavored with vanilla. The contrast between the crunchy crust and the soft interior makes it a delightful treat. Takis Fuego
Takis Fuego are intensely flavored, rolled corn chips coated in a fiery chili and lime seasoning. They offer a uniquely crunchy texture and a significant kick of heat that appeals to those who enjoy bold flavors.
